Output fda60d062b8fab91f7e1cb84a2edcf58d77f84bfd64e833498db31c4eb985ef4:1

value
186361
script pubkey
OP_0 OP_PUSHBYTES_20 83c198648f47502d882e381a6392f4f79b83bc0c
address
bc1qs0qesey0gagzmzpw8qdx8yh577dc80qvs0vyg5
transaction
fda60d062b8fab91f7e1cb84a2edcf58d77f84bfd64e833498db31c4eb985ef4
confirmations
136613
spent
true